What is a Yurt?
A circular, inviting, insulated abode, with skylight-dome,
offering comfort and warmth (physically and aesthetically). The Yurt is a 30 ft. round structure built into the woods on the Lakeside
property. The yurt includes 2 bedrooms with queen sized beds. The loft holds a
double bed and single mattresses are available as well. The living area has two
couches, each with a hide-a-bed (one double and one queen). There is a deck with
sitting and eating space as well as an indoor kitchen and dining area. The
maximum capacity for the yurt is 10 people.
